Sat 1861656735258178

decimal
668650.485258178
degree
0°38650′1354″485258178‴
percentile
88.6503208240953%
name
aqwhwrrfopb
cycle
0
epoch
3
period
331
block
668650
offset
485258178
timestamp
rarity
common